DAAD Diagnostic Messages continued
Message Description Recommended Action
Threshold for drive (bay)
X violated
This message indicates
that a monitor and
performance threshold for
this drive has been
violated.
Check for the particular threshold that has been
violated.
Threshold violations for
drive (bay) X
This is a list of the
individual thresholds that
have been violated for this
drive.
The drive may need to be replaced. Run the
Compaq Diagnostics Utility to determine if the
drive has been initialized and the threshold
violation warrants drive replacement.
Unknown disable code A code was returned from
the array accelerator board
that DAAD does not
recognize.
Call your Authorized Compaq Reseller for the
latest version of DAAD.
Warning bit detected A monitor and
performance threshold
violation may have
occurred. The status of a
logical drive may not be
OK.
Check the other error messages for an
indication of the problem.
WARNING - Drive Write
Cache is enabled on X
Drive has its internal write
cache enabled. The drive
may be a third-party drive
or the drive’s operating
parameters may have
been altered. Condition
may cause data corruption
if power to the drive is
interrupted.
Replace the drive with a Compaq supplied
drive, or restore the drive’s operating
parameters.
